Hi, thanks for your enthusiasm. Unfortunately, FreeIPA server is
currently a long way from being useful on Debian.
- 389-ds-base just got updated so that it builds again, but updating
from 3.1.2 breaks build on at least i386
- dogtag-pki is unavailable, because it didn't support tomcat10 for a
long time. Now that it finally does since last year, jss first needs
some work to actually build the tomcatjss bits that got merged to it.
Then dogtag itself probably needs a heap of work.. Expertise in
packaging java (maven) apps is a must here, at least for jss
- bind-dyndb-ldap does not support bind9 9.20+, and adding support is
still WIP upstream:
https://codeberg.org/freeipa/bind-dyndb-ldap/pulls/244
even when it lands, it would be best to bundle with the bind9 upstream,
which was at least blocked by bind-dyndb-ldap being licensed as GPLv3
instead of MPL-2:
https://codeberg.org/freeipa/bind-dyndb-ldap/issues/225
(hopefully it'll get merged to upstream bind9 eventually)
And once we have all of these, we can start working on the server
itself, which has likely changed in ways that require a bunch of
modifications for Debian..
